Warning Signs You Need Dishwasher Leak Water Damage Restoration
Catching these signs early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ore the warning signs, they’re often the first indication that something is seriously wrong. Don’t wait until it’s too late.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ell can show that water has seeped into your home’s walls or flooring, creating a breeding ground for mold and mildew. Act quickly to prevent further damage.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a leaky dishwasher, a burst pipe, or other water damage issues. Don’t delay the longer you wait, the more damage will occur.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show that water has seeped into your home’s subfloor or foundation. Take action to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Increased Humidity or Mold Growth
High humidity or visible mold growth can show that water is present in your home, creating an environment conducive to mold and mildew growth. Don’t ignore the signs they can lead to serious health issues.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ks from your dishwasher or other appliances can show a serious issue. Act qu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Visible Water Damage
Visible water damage, including water spots, warping, or discoloration, can show that a leak has occurred. Don’t wait the longer you wait, the more damage will occur.

Dishwasher Leak Water Damage Cost In Oakdale, MN
The cost of dishwasher leak water damage restoration can vary widely dep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Oakdale, MN. These estimates are based on industry averages and may not reflect the actual cost of your specific project. Get a free estimate to find out the cost of your restoration.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ed |
| Demolition and debris removal |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ials damaged, and labor required |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ials needed, and labor required |
| Final inspection and cleaning |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and labor required |
| IICRC certification and training | $500 – $2,000 | Technician’s level of experience and certification required |
| Equipment rental and usage |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and equipment needed |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ment and evaluation of your specific situation. Get a free estimate to find out the cost of your restoration.

How do I prevent future dishwasher leaks?
Regular maintenance is key to preventing future dishwasher leaks. Check your dishwasher’s hoses and connections regularly, and consider installing a water leak detector to alert you to any issues. Stay ahead of the game with regular maintenance and inspections.
What happens if I don’t address the issue quickly?
Delaying the restoration process can lead to further damage, increased costs, and even health risks. Mold and mildew growth can occur within 24-48 hours, making it essential to address the issue quickly. Don’t wait, act now.
